Montuori Tire
Information
Phone | (978) 343-6971 |
---|---|
Fax | (978) 345-9760 - Fax |
Address |
180 Main St, Fitchburg, MA 01420-7838 United States |
Description
553123 - Tire-Dealers-Retail
Reviews for Montuori Tire
It looks like this business doesn't have any reviews yet. Why not be the first?
Is this your business? Claim and update it!
Similar Tire And Repair Shop Listings
-
Tire Warehouse
212 Bemis Rd, Fitchburg, MA
-
Expert Tire
507 John Fitch Hwy, Fitchburg, MA